What Are The Key Features?
Provides a searchable list and map view of over 160 rockhounding locations across the US.
Allows users to plot their own GPS coordinates to add personal sites to the map.
Features a reference guide of over 60 minerals with full-screen images and descriptions.
Enables users to add their own finds to the app with custom photos and descriptions.
